I. Flexibility and Autonomy: Redefining Work-Life Balance
One of the key contributors to the success of freelancing is the unparalleled flexibility and autonomy it offers. Freelancers have the freedom to set their own schedules, choose their projects, and work from anywhere in the world. This flexibility not only allows individuals to tailor their work to their lifestyle but also fosters a sense of autonomy and control over one's professional destiny.
II. Global Talent Pool: Accessing Skills Beyond Borders
The advent of online freelancing platforms has connected businesses with a global talent pool. Freelancers can collaborate with clients from different corners of the world, bringing diverse skills, perspectives, and expertise to the table. III. Entrepreneurial Spirit: Building Personal Brands
Freelancing encourages an entrepreneurial mindset, pushing individuals to build and market their personal brands. Success in freelancing is not solely based on skill but also on the ability to effectively communicate one's value proposition. This entrepreneurial spirit fosters creativity, innovation, and a proactive approach to career development.
